Being a parent is the most difficult job in the world and moms and dads need all the help they can get! The oldest parents magazine in America is simply titled Parents. Its readership is mainly women, aged 18 - 35 years old but it entertains and informs outside of that demographic and there are features with fathers in mind. The publication appears in print, on its website and broadcasts regular podcasts. Readers can also post their blogs and comments on the Goodyblog section and message boards.

There is a loyal core of readers and circulation is a steady 2 million. Every aspect of looking after a baby, toddler or young child is explored in articles and advice columns. In fact, topics on pregnancy are covered too and there is a helpful index of baby names to help parents to make that all important choice.  Parents are naturally concerned with issues such as discipline, education and nutrition. The health of child and mother is discussed and how to keep a child safe. Parents magazine is not all serious however, and there are articles on beauty, the home and fashion. Experts know that it’s important for mom to be fit and healthy too and there is advice on fitness workouts and having a balanced diet.

The concerns that parents deal with on a daily basis are addressed, such as getting baby to sleep and how to cope with food allergies. Parents magazine employ the expertise of specialists in the field of obstetrics, gynecology, child psychology and child development. Regular columns include As They Grow, covering the subject of child development at different ages. There are reviews of toys and equipment such as cycle helmets. Adoption and fertility issues are also covered. Nothing is left out, from taking a child for their first haircut to telling him or her about the facts of life.

Food is another issue that can worry parents. They want their kids to be healthy but to enjoy their meals. The online recipe search is a useful resource, bringing inspiration and ideas. The search facility can be used for a general search and the index is divided into sections for a more detailed browse. Categories include occasions such as Halloween, the 4th of July, Easter and Passover and Mothers Day or Fathers Day. Whatever the subject, Parents magazine is there to lend a hand.
